Tolkien Studies: Volume 12
EditorDavid Bratman, Michael D.C. Drout, Verlyn Flieger
PublisherWest Virginia University Press
Released2015
FormatPaperback

Tolkien Studies: Volume 12 is the twelfth volume of the annual review Tolkien Studies.

Contents

  • Articles
    • Kelly M. Wickham-Crowley,'Mind to Mind': Tolkien's Faërian Drama and the Middle English Sir Orfeo
    • Kris Swank, "The Irish Otherworld Voyage of Roverandom"
    • Simon Cook, "The Peace of Frodo: On the Origin of an English Mythology"
    • Carrol Fry, 'Two Musics about the Throne of Ilúvatar': Gnostic and Manichaean Dualism in The Silmarillion
    • Alban Gautier, "From Dejection in Winter to Victory in Spring: Aragorn and Alfred, Parallel Episodes?"
    • Sherrylyn Branchaw, "Boromir: Breaker of the Fellowship?"
  • Book Reviews
    • Beowulf: A Translation and Commentary together with Sellic Spell, by J.R.R. Tolkien, edited by Christopher Tolkien, reviewed by Michael D.C. Drout
    • The Adventures of Tom Bombadil and Other Verses from the Red Book, by J.R.R. Tolkien, edited by Christina Scull and Wayne G. Hammond, reviewed by Richard C. West
    • A Companion to J.R.R. Tolkien, edited by Stuart D. Lee, reviewed by Jorge Luis Bueno-Alonso
    • Tolkien: The Forest and the City, edited by Helen Conrad-O'Briain and Gerard Hynes, reviewed by Patrick Curry
    • Tolkien, by Raymond Edwards, reviewed by David Bratman
    • "The Year's Work in Tolkien Studies 2012," by Merlin DeTardo, Jason Fisher, David Bratman, Marjorie Burns, John Wm. Houghton, John Magoun
    • "Bibliography (in English) for 2013," compiled by Rebecca Epstein and David Bratman
